Call of Duty: Modern Warfarefeatures a Message of the Day that lets the developers highlight new content or point out features that some fans may not have realized are in the game. However, theCall of Duty: Modern WarfareMessage of the Day has drummed up some controversy in the past, with some claiming thatInfinity Ward was using the Message of the Day to trollabout things like claymores, which were notoriously overpowered before getting nerfed. Now some players are finding a new Message of the Day that promotes PS4-exclusive content on PC.

Reddit user yp261 posted a screenshot of a newCall of Duty: Modern WarfareMessage of the Day that promotes the PS4-exclusive Spec Ops Survival mode, even though they were playing on PC. Spec Ops Survival is a timed-PS4 exclusive that won’t be available to PC or Xbox One players until November 2020, which is something that has been met with significant backlash since it was announced. The post has over 1,000 upvotes and appears to be legitimate, though we didn’t see this particular Message of the Day when checking on Xbox One.

It’s possible thatInfinity Wardaccidentally featured this Message of the Day to players on PC and Xbox One and removed it. It’s also possible that some Message of the Day posts are unique to certain players. We also can’t rule out the possibility that this was faked since we were unable to verify its existence in our own testing. Whatever the case may be, it still highlights the continued disappointment from fans aboutSpec Ops Survival being a timed-PS4 exclusivefor such an extensive period of time.

On the bright side, it doesn’t seem like PC and Xbox One players are really missing out on all that much when it comes to Spec Ops Survival. Fans responded to yp261’s thread reassuring them that Spec Ops Survival in the newCall of Duty: Modern Warfarepales in comparison to the version of the mode that was featured inModern Warfare 3. This wouldn’t be all that surprising, as the Spec Ops co-op mode in the newModern Warfaredoes appear to have been an afterthought compared to the campaign and multiplayer, launching with just a singleclassic Spec Ops missionand being plagued by a whole host of technical issues on the Operations maps.

Regardless of its quality, the timed-exclusivity of Spec Ops Survival has understandably rubbed some fans the wrong way, and this Message of the Day would be like pouring salt in the wound for players who are still upset by it. It also comes at an especially bad PR time for Infinity Ward, as the studio is being widely criticized for a perceived lack of communication since launch, with many fans expressing their disappointment overCall of Duty: Modern Warfareupdate 1.09failing to address community concerns about the game. This Message of the Day will potentially just sour some fans even more on the game and the studio.
